Notes about Lubbertus Patroclus Pentermann

Corrie Foppes (1923) schrijft over haar neef Bert Pentermann:
Na het overlijden van zijn vader Emo, toen hij nog maar zes jaar oud was, is hij tot zijn 12e aan ons gezicht onttrokken geweest. Hij heeft daarna een aantal jaren bij ons in Meppel gewoond, is na zijn vertrek naar Groningen, studerend aan de Hogere Landbouwschool geheel uit het zicht verdwenen en daarin anno 1996 weer opgedoken.Tot ons genoegen. Zijn deelneming aan het Landbouwonderwijs in Groningen heeft hem een levensrelatie opgeleverd in de vorm van een medestudente: JANS DIETE DIJKSTRA * 31 / 7 / 1931 die zijn echtgenote werd.Het paar kreeg twee zonen:EMO JOHAN PENTERMANN, * 30 / 1958 en W ILLEM TIETE POPKE PENTERMANNN *14 / 10 / 1960.
De beide jongens hebben het “verderop” gezocht :Emo woont in Longmont ,Col. U.S.A. Willem, getrouwd, is manager in een van de grote hotels in Bankok, Thailand. Aardig is misschien nog te vermelden dat Bertus Pentermann twee zilveren kommen in zijn bezit heeft, die afkomstig zijn ,volgensde inscriptie van het echtpaar Lubbertus Patroclus Romelingh, (9 /8 / 1722----+11 / 8 / 1778) en Baugjen Oostingh,(30 / 12 / 1731---+10 / 1 / 1822). Een tweede gravering behelst de initialen van L.P.R. en T.W.M (Tietje Medendorp), onze over-overgrootvader dus. Daarna zijn de kommen overgegaan naar diens kleinzoon L.P. Pentermann, Sr. en vervolgens naar de volgende kleinzoon L.P.Pentermann Jr. Wat je noemt ,historische familiestukken: IN ERE HOUDEN ,dus !!!!! Tot zover de nazaten van Emo Pentermann en Jantina Helder.
